Activities and Events
On this day, various activities are organized to engage the public and raise awareness about the vital role of maritime forces. Events range from parades and ceremonies to educational programs and community outreach initiatives.
- **Parades and Demonstrations**: Many coastal cities host parades featuring ships and personnel showcasing their skills.
- **Community Engagement**: Local organizations often set up booths to educate the public about maritime safety and security.
- **Ceremonial Events**: Tributes are paid to fallen heroes, with memorial services held in their honor.
- **Educational Workshops**: Schools and community centers may offer workshops on marine conservation and safety practices.
